Senior medics to get above inflation pay rise, Scottish Government announces

Consultants, GPs, specialty, specialist and associate specialist (SAS) doctors and dentists will receive a 3.5% increase for 2026-27.
Salaried community and public dental workers will have a 3.75% pay uplift.
“It is, therefore, right that we recognise this by accepting the independent findings of the DDRB to deliver an equitable and affordable pay deal – one that is in line with other public sector pay awards for 2026-27.
Angela Constance (Image: PA)“We remain committed to a fair, evidence-based and independent approach to pay awards and in accepting the DDRB recommendations in full, we are supporting recruitment and retention.
The Scottish Government said consultants were previously awarded a 6% pay rise in 2023-24, 10.5% in 2024-25, and 4% in 2025-26.
